Fire door hardware describes the different elements installed on fire doors to guarantee they operate appropriately during an emergency. These parts are made to hold up against high temperatures and avoid the spread of fire and smoke, providing crucial time for passengers to evacuate securely. Let's explore the various kinds of hardware required on a fire door.
What Hardware is Required on a Fire Door?
To make certain ideal efficiency, fire doors need to be equipped with certain hardware. Here's a malfunction of the key elements:
1. Hinges - Fire door joints are specifically made to remain practical under severe warmth conditions. They are typically made from materials like stainless-steel to provide toughness and toughness.
2. Locks and Latches - These devices guarantee the door stays firmly closed during a fire, avoiding the passage of fire and smoke. Fire-rated locks and latches need to satisfy stringent criteria to ensure dependability in emergency situation scenarios.
3. Door Closers - Automatic door closers are important for fire doors, guaranteeing they close totally after being opened. This protects against the spread of fire and smoke via open entrances.
Fire Door Hinges
Fire door hinges play a important function in preserving the door's structural integrity during a fire. They are made from durable products that can stand up to high temperatures without deforming. These joints have to be set up correctly to ensure the door runs smoothly and closes securely.
Fire Rated Locks and Latches
Fire-rated locks and latches are important for ensuring that fire doors remain shut during a fire. These parts are checked to endure heats and should meet certain criteria to be considered fire-rated. Correct setup and upkeep are vital to guarantee their effectiveness in an emergency.
Relevance of Door Closers
Door closers are a essential part of fire door hardware. They automatically close the door after it has been opened, making certain that the door remains shut and stops the spread of fire and smoke. Fire-rated door closers are made to run reliably under extreme warm problems.
What is the feature of fire door hardware?
The key feature of fire door hardware is to boost the door's ability to include fire and smoke. Right here's exactly how each part adds to this objective:
1. Joints - High-quality fire-rated joints ensure the door remains securely affixed to the structure, also under intense heat. This protects against the door from warping or separating, which might jeopardize its efficiency.
2. Locks and Latches - These elements assist maintain the integrity of the fire door by maintaining it shut. In the event of a fire, a locked door can prevent flames and smoke from infecting various other areas.
3. Door Closers - By automatically shutting the door, these gadgets aid to separate the fire and have it within a certain location, reducing the threat of it spreading out throughout the building.
3-Hour Fire Rated Door Hardware
Fire doors are rated based upon the amount of time they can stand up to fire exposure. A 3-hour fire-rated door is made to offer 3 hours of protection prior to succumbing to the fires. The hardware used on these doors have to also be ranked to ensure they can do under such conditions. This consists of hinges, locks, latches, and door closers that are tested and licensed for three-hour fire resistance.
Choosing the Right Fire Door Hardware
Choosing the appropriate fire door hardware is important for guaranteeing the door's performance throughout a fire. Here are some ideas for picking the best hardware:
1. Accreditation - Always pick hardware that is tested and certified for fire resistance. Try to find items that fulfill industry standards and have gone through strenuous screening.
2. Product - Opt for hardware made from sturdy products like stainless steel, which can stand up to heats without compromising performance.
3. Compatibility - Ensure that the hardware you select is compatible with your fire door and frame. Improperly fitted hardware can decrease the door's efficiency.
Upkeep of Fire Door Hardware
Normal maintenance is necessary to make certain that fire door hardware continues to be useful and reputable. This consists of:
1. Evaluation - Regularly inspect all components for signs of wear or damage. Replace any type of broken components quickly to maintain the door's effectiveness.
2. Testing - Periodically test the door's capability, consisting of the operation of joints, locks, latches, and door closers. Make certain that the door closes effectively and stays securely closed.
3. Lubrication - Apply lubrication to relocating parts to make certain smooth operation. Use lubricating substances suggested by the hardware supplier to prevent harming the components.

Typical Myths About Fire Door Hardware
There are a number of mistaken beliefs about fire door hardware. Allow's unmask a few of the most usual myths:
1. All Hinges Are the Same - Not all joints are fire-rated. It's important to use qualified fire door hinges that can hold up against high temperatures.
2. Any Kind Of Lock Will Do - Only fire-rated locks and latches are designed to preserve the door's honesty during a fire. Routine locks might stop working under intense heat.
3. Upkeep Isn't Important - Regular upkeep of fire door hardware is important for ensuring its performance. Overlooking upkeep can endanger the door's performance.
